Abstract
The invention discloses a rotary kiln brickwork supporting device, which comprises a connecting pipe, an adjusting pipe and a jack, one end of the connecting pipe is provided with an internal thread, a first flange is welded on the other end of the connecting pipe, one end of the adjusting pipe is provided with an external thread, the connecting pipe is connected with the adjusting pipe through the matching between the internal thread and the external thread, a second flange is welded on one end of the base of the jack, the connecting pipe is connected with the jack through the first flange, the second flange and bolt-nut assemblies, the other end of the adjusting pipe is connected with a cylindrical disk, the outer end surface of the cylindrical disk is connected with spikes, and the outer end of the piston of the jack is connected with a second connecting disk, which is connected with spikes. The rotary kiln brickwork supporting device has a compact structure, is convenient to dismount, mount and operate, decreases the labor intensity of operators, increases labor efficiency, is highly safe and reliable, and also reduces the number of operators.

Background technology
The rotary kiln that prior art cement clinker production line adopts, need when kiln makes to lay bricks, need to use bracing or strutting arrangement laying bricks in technique, the defect that bracing or strutting arrangement used in the prior art exists is, during use, the harrow nail supported on the disk at two ends is pricked into chock, sleeper is held out against by rotating nut thrust tube connector, originally refractory brick is fixed in support, someone bracing or strutting arrangement must be shouldered during construction, he also needs other people to fix sleeper, there is other people tightening nut again, many people are needed to operate, take a lot of work, effort, operator's labour intensity is large, inefficiency, and due to the instrument that adopts and the quality of materials weight of constructing, opereating specification is little, action is inconvenient, handling safety hidden danger.

Beneficial effect of the present invention:
1. compact conformation of the present invention, reduces the labour intensity of operator, improves efficiency, easy to operate, security reliability is high, decreases the quantity of operator simultaneously.
2. internal thread of the present invention, external screw thread adopt trapezoidal thread, adopt trapezoidal thread transmitting force, and the axial force that can bear is large, and transmission efficiency is high, for transmitting motion and power, and can Bidirectional driving, processing easier in square thread.
3. jack adopts 20t hand jack, and a flange is respectively welded in one end of jack base and tube connector, and two flange bolts connect, and connects reliable, and installation for convenience detach.,
4. the length of tube connector trapezoidal thread is 400mm, is cooperatively interacted, facilitate adjustable range by trapezoidal thread and adjustable pipe, and jack spindle nose end is connected with the second terminal pad, is enclosed within jack spindle nose outer end, adjusts distance during use, rotates jack.
5. the second terminal pad is flexibly connected with piston outer face by moving casing, easy accessibility, easily changes after wearing and tearing.
